Output 42db6a52a00c86fa63c7e7d670c99420e1c4bfbb86f929b2b15f00fd5bf66816:0

value
399500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8420254d59600e7ebe2a52e484633f4717d0a4af OP_EQUALVERIFY OP_CHECKSIG
address
1D3chqzvyn9yBetMyM6D8EdWaE2DAVsPjj
transaction
42db6a52a00c86fa63c7e7d670c99420e1c4bfbb86f929b2b15f00fd5bf66816
spent
true